Coordinated action by governments will be essential to meeting the climate challenge. We support global mandatory greenhouse gas emission to reduce emissions by at least 50 percent below 1990 levels by 2050.
Business must also play a significant role and Motorola Solutions is taking action in three ways:
We have reduced our carbon footprint by 45 percent and our energy use by 28 percent since 2005. Our continual focus on reducing energy use in our buildings brings significant costs savings, manages the risk of rising energy prices and prepares us for expected regulations.
Climate change also presents a significant business opportunity for Motorola Solutions and others in the Information and Communications Technology (ICT) industry. The SMART 2020 industry report has identified opportunities to use ICT equipment to reduce global emissions by 15 percent by 2020. This year we launched a new climate change strategy, having met our absolute and normalized greenhouse gas reduction targets up until 2010. This includes a goal to increase our use of electricity from renewable sources to 30 percent by 2020.
We are assessing the lifecycle climate impacts of our products, making our products more energy efficient and using alternative energy sources where appropriate.
Motorola Solutions also contributes to climate change through the activities of our suppliers. Our long-term goal is to measure and reduce the climate impact of our supply chain.
